8000 GitHub - thifacco/swui-angular: 👾 Aplicação UI para SWAPI desenvolvida com Angular 15+
[go: up one dir, main page]
More Web Proxy on the site http://driver.im/
Skip to content

thifacco/swui-angular

Repository files navigation

Logo of the project

Star Wars UI

Essa é uma aplicação desenvolvida com Angular para treinar consumo de API proposto pelo desafio #7DaysOfCode da Alura.

Tecnologias

Essas foram as tecnologias usadas nesse projeto:

  • Angular versão 15.2.0

Serviços

  • Node

NPM packages

  • Material Design
  • RxJS

Getting started

  • Dependências

    • Node
  • Para instalar as dependências do projeto:

npm install
  • Para iniciar a aplicação:
npm start

Esse comando irá iniciar a aplicação e abrir automaticamente o endereço http://localhost:4200/ no navegador.

Como usar a aplicação

1 - Quando você acessar a url do projeto, verá a Home Page.

Homepage image

2 - Você pode navegar pela página de Filmes.

movies

3 - Você pode navegar pela página de Naves.

starships

Features

As principais funcionalidades dessa aplicação são:

  • Página principal da aplicação
    • exibe campo de busca por nome de personagens de Star Wars
    • lista numa mat-table os nomes encontrados
  • Página de Filmes
    • lista numa mat-table com todos os filmes da franquia Star Wars
  • Página de Naves
    • exibe campo de busca por nome da nave da franquia Star Wars
    • lista numa mat-table as naves encontradas na busca ou a listagem completa delas
    • exibe detalhes de cada nave em cada item da mat-table
    • paginação de resultados

Links

Versioning

1.7.4

Autor

  • Tiago Luis Facco

Siga-me no github e vamos juntos! Obrigado pela visita e bons códigos!

About

👾 Aplicação UI para SWAPI desenvolvida com Angular 15+

Topics

Resources

Stars

Watchers

Forks

Releases

No releases published

Packages

No packages published
0